Output 381e7aedc04eb91a5870060a088e2010ecd77f5aa261544abc86880e54d05d06:123

value
330606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3eb8a90bd96c1044fda1fc1242ec25fa163b90 OP_EQUAL
address
3BqE4nrBo7kX1oEn28zME7gZYRGJxiYtbK
transaction
381e7aedc04eb91a5870060a088e2010ecd77f5aa261544abc86880e54d05d06
spent
true